Side-by-side comparison
Kommissar | Beholder 2 | |
|---|---|---|
| Released | 2017 | 2018 |
| Genres | Strategy, Indie, Adventure, Simulation, Early Access, Violent | Strategy, Indie, Adventure, Simulation |
| Platforms | Windows | Windows, macOS, Linux |
| Steam Deck | Unrated | Deck Verified |
| Price | 8.99 USD | 17.99 USD |
| Steam reviews | 13% positive (23 reviews) | 82.4% positive (1,028 reviews) |
| Multiplayer | Single-player only | Single-player only |
| Developers | Beardserk | Alawar Stargaze (Warm Lamp Games) |
